In the countryside around Hantes-Wihéries

This walk will take you on a tour of the village of Hantes-Wihéries and the surrounding countryside. The route offers beautiful panoramic views of the Hantes valley and the village. It is a mixed route combining farm tracks and small village roads.

Description of the walk

The starting point of the walk is on Place Robaulx.

(S/E) With your back to the gate of Robaulx Castle, take the street to the right. At the junction with Rue du Jeu de Balle, turn left. Turn left into Rue des Fontaines and walk past the old buildings of the ‘ferme d’en-bas’ and Château Lengrand.

(1) Opposite the village church, turn right onto Rue d’en-Bas and follow it straight on until you reach Route de Thuin.

(2) Turn left, cross the bridge over the Hantes and you’ll come to a junction.

(3) On the left, take the dirt track and, after the bridge, continue left onto the old Chimay track. Wind your way through the fields to reach Rue de Wihéries.
At the fork, turn right and carry on for 100 m.

(4) Turn left onto the road that descends steeply. Cross the River Hantes again and pass close to the restaurant: Le Grand Pré. Carry on through the hamlet, which consists of houses built from local stone.

(5) Just past a farm building, take the sharp right-hand bend onto a narrow path. This is a former local tramway track. Continue across the meadows and then through the woods until you reach the road.

(6) At the junction, turn left. At the top of the hill, take the farm track on the left and continue across the fields until you reach a junction.

(7) Take the hairpin bend to the right and carry on south-east until you reach a cross-road.

(8) Turn right, cross the woodland and continue along the path, winding its way through fields and meadows.

(9) At the junction with the Chemin de la Drève, turn left. The road first descends steeply before climbing again, passing a few houses in the village of Montignies-Saint-Christophe. At the top of the hill, turn left onto the farm track and continue across the fields.

(10) Just past a solitary tree, at the crossroads, turn left onto theGR® 125-129 long-distance footpath.
At a place called Chapelle Berteaux, at the junction formed by the farm tracks, carry straight on to head down towards the village of Hantes-Wihéries.

(11) Turn left onto the small path running alongside a stone wall, then turn right to reach the Place du Jeu de Balle.

(12) At the crossroads, turn left and head downhill alongside the houses.

(13) A little further down from the junction with Rue Wez Gobeau, turn right to continue along the old tram line. Walk alongside the River Hantes. At the pétanque court, turn right towards the houses. At the junction with Rue de l’Église, turn right then immediately left to head back up Rue Chêneau.

(14) At the top of the street, turn left onto Rue du Jeu de Balle. Take the first left to return to the starting point at Place Robaulx (S/E).
